Why Your Ceramic Coating Might Be Wearing Out Faster
Ceramic coatings are built to last, but even the toughest layers can degrade faster than expected—especially in our area. If your coating isn’t holding up like it should, the culprit is often hiding in plain sight: daily driving conditions, maintenance habits, or even how it was applied in the first place.
Houston’s Climate Is Tough on Coatings
Our local weather doesn’t do your vehicle’s finish any favors. Intense UV exposure, high humidity, and sudden temperature swings break down ceramic coatings over time. The sun’s rays cause oxidation, while moisture promotes water spots and mineral deposits that etch into the surface. Even the best coatings need extra attention here.
Heat and UV Damage
Houston’s long, hot summers accelerate the breakdown of polymers in ceramic coatings. UV rays penetrate the layer, weakening its hydrophobic properties and gloss. Without protection, your paint underneath suffers too—leading to fading and dullness.
Humidity and Contaminants
High humidity means more than just discomfort. It keeps surfaces damp longer, allowing pollutants, bird droppings, and bug splatter to bond tightly to the coating. These acidic contaminants eat away at the layer if not removed promptly, shortening its lifespan.
Improper Application Shortens Lifespan
Not all ceramic coatings fail because of the environment. A rushed or incorrect application can doom it from the start. If the paint wasn’t properly prepped with correction and polishing, imperfections get locked under the coating, compromising adhesion and durability.
Skipping Paint Correction
Paint correction isn’t just about looks—it’s critical for longevity. Swirl marks, scratches, or oxidation left untreated prevent the coating from bonding fully. The result? Premature peeling or uneven wear.

Maintenance Mistakes That Hurt Your Coating
Even a flawless application won’t last without proper care. Harsh chemicals, automatic car washes, and improper drying techniques can strip away the coating’s protective qualities.
Using the Wrong Cleaners
Household detergents, dish soaps, or ammonia-based cleaners break down the coating’s hydrophobic layer. Always use pH-neutral car shampoos and microfiber wash mitts to preserve the finish.
Automatic Car Washes
Brushes and harsh chemicals in automatic car washes create micro-scratches and wear down the coating. Hand washing is safer, but if you must use a drive-through, opt for touchless options.
Neglecting Regular Upkeep
Ceramic coatings aren’t maintenance-free. They still need regular washing and occasional reapplication of a ceramic boost spray to refresh hydrophobicity. Skipping this leads to faster degradation.
Common Contaminants That Attack Coatings
Some enemies of ceramic coatings are unavoidable, but knowing them helps you act fast.
Bird Droppings and Bug Splatter
These aren’t just unsightly—they’re acidic. Left too long, they etch into the coating, leaving permanent marks. Always remove them as soon as possible with a gentle cleaner.
Water Spots and Mineral Deposits
Hard water leaves behind minerals that build up on the surface. Over time, these spots become embedded, dulling the finish and reducing the coating’s effectiveness.
Industrial Fallout and Pollen
Houston’s urban and suburban areas expose vehicles to industrial pollutants and pollen. These particles bond to the coating, requiring specialized cleaners to remove safely.
How to Extend Your Coating’s Life
The good news? You can slow down wear with the right habits.
Wash Regularly (But Gently)
Stick to a two-bucket wash method with grit guards to avoid swirls. Dry with a clean microfiber towel to prevent water spots.
Apply a Ceramic Boost Spray
Every few months, use a ceramic detailer or boost spray to replenish the hydrophobic layer. This keeps water beading and protection strong between full coatings.
Park Smart
Whenever possible, park in a garage or under a cover to shield your vehicle from UV rays, bird droppings, and tree sap.
Address Damage Early
If you notice water no longer beads or the surface looks dull, it may be time for a professional inspection. Sometimes, a light polish and reapplication of the coating can restore protection.
When to Consider a Fresh Coating
Even with perfect care, ceramic coatings don’t last forever. Most professional-grade coatings last 2–5 years, but harsh conditions can shorten that. If your coating no longer repels water or dirt clings stubbornly, it’s time for a refresh.
